Java字符串按位置替代教程
引言
作为一名经验丰富的开发者,我们经常会遇到需要对字符串进行替换操作的情况。在Java中,我们可以通过一些简单的步骤来实现按位置替代字符串的功能。在本篇文章中,我将教会你如何通过Java代码来实现这一功能。
实现流程
下面是实现“Java字符串按位置替代”的流程图:
erDiagram
实现流程 {
开始 --> 创建字符串
创建字符串 --> 定义替换位置和替换字符
定义替换位置和替换字符 --> 执行替换操作
执行替换操作 --> 输出替换后的字符串
输出替换后的字符串 --> 结束
}
步骤及代码示例
步骤一:创建字符串
首先,我们需要创建一个原始的字符串,我们将对这个字符串进行替换操作。
String originalString = "Hello, World!";
步骤二:定义替换位置和替换字符
接下来,我们需要定义要替换的位置和替换的字符。例如,我们将在原始字符串的第五个字符位置替换成字符'A'。
int replaceIndex = 4; // 替换位置索引,注意索引从0开始
char replaceChar = 'A'; // 替换的字符
步骤三:执行替换操作
然后,我们使用String的substring()方法和charAt()方法来替换字符串的指定位置的字符。
String replacedString = originalString.substring(0, replaceIndex) + replaceChar + originalString.substring(replaceIndex + 1);
步骤四:输出替换后的字符串
最后,我们可以输出替换后的字符串,查看替换是否成功。
System.out.println("替换后的字符串为:" + replacedString);
总结
通过以上步骤,我们可以很容易地实现Java字符串按位置替代的功能。记住,关键在于理解substring()和charAt()方法的使用,以及如何根据替换位置来替换字符。希望这篇文章能帮助你更好地理解和掌握字符串替换操作。
希望你能够通过这篇教程学会如何在Java中实现字符串按位置替代的功能,祝你编程愉快!